
FUNCTION SETUP
How to navigate through “HDMI Multi(LPCM)”.
1
2
Use [K/ L] to select your desired menu item then press [ENTER]. Use [K/ L] to select your setting items.
• Press [RETURN] to go back to the previous screen.
3Use [s/ B] to select desired options. (Except for “Test Tone”, “Default” and setting options in “Speaker Size” setting.)
For setting options in “Speaker Size” setting:
Press [ENTER] to select desired options.
For “Test Tone”:
Use [s/ B] to select “Off”, “Manual” or “Auto”, then press [ENTER].
•The test tone will be output. If you select “Manual”, use [K/L] to select desired speaker, then use [s/B] to adjust the volume. If you select “Auto”, use [s/B] to adjust the volume of the speaker that outputs the test tone.
•If you want to stop the test tone, press [RETURN].
For “Default”:
Press [ENTER] to reset to the default.
